Diamond Mesh Reinforcing for Plaster

Diamond mesh reinforcement plays a vital role in enhancing the strength of plaster applications. This robust material, typically manufactured from galvanized steel wires, provides exceptional tensile resistance. When integrated into plaster walls or ceilings, diamond mesh successfully prevents cracking caused by physical stresses.

The unique interlocking structure of diamond mesh allows the plaster to bond firmly, creating a more consistent surface finish. Furthermore, it strengthens the overall structural integrity of the plasterwork, making it more long-lasting.

Benefits and Techniques of Diamond Mesh in Plastering

Diamond mesh provides numerous plusses for plastering applications. This robust mesh helps to bolster the plaster surface, making it more resistant to damage. By distributing stress across a wider area, diamond mesh prevents the likelihood of visible issues.

Applying diamond mesh involves several key techniques. First, clean the surface by removing any loose particles or debris. Then, install a layer of plaster over the substrate, ensuring adequate coverage for the mesh. Next, firmly secure the diamond mesh into the wet plaster, overlapping adjacent pieces to create a seamless grid. Finally, check here finish the final layer of plaster, smoothing and leveling the surface for a professional look.
